Nordia 45, CONSTANTIA is a spectacular yacht for her age and built for long distance cruising. She has been much updated in this ownership. This includes, in 2023, an extensive list of maintenance jobs - most notably sandblasting, with new paint on the hull, as well as new anodes and prop clean plus much more.

Construction

RCD Status: Our understanding is that the yacht is exempt from the essential safety requirements of the Recreational Craft Directive as she was built and placed into use within the EU prior to 1998.

 

Hull, Deck & Superstructure Construction:

  • Corten steel hull. 2021 ultrasound readings available, all 3.9mm plus.
  • Hull, transom, deck, rudder - all built in 4mm steel. Superstructure built in 3-4mm.
  • Round bilge.
  • Teak laid decks (1991). When new – 18mm thick with 12mm underlay.
  • Blue painted hull.

 

Keel & Rudder:

  • Keel built in 10mm steel.
  • Long keel.
  • 9.5 tons iron ballast.

Machinery

Engine & Gearboxes:

  • 2 x 80hp Mercedes OM601 (1992).
  • 2 x ZF Hurth marine HBW 360-3R gearboxes.
  • Oil lubricated shafts.
  • New starter motors and alternators (2020).

 

Maintenance & Performance:

  • Engine hours – approx. 1,553 and 1,562 as of July 2021.
  • Engine last serviced July 2021.
  • Cruising speed – approx. 6.5 knots.
  • Maximum speed – approx. 8.5 knots.
  • Fuel consumption at cruising speed – approx. 3.5 litres per hour, each engine.
  • Range between 800 and 1000nm.

 

Propulsion & Steering:

  • 2 x 3-bladed fixed propellers, stainless steel.
  • Bow thruster (motor replaced 2021).

Electrical Systems

Voltage Systems:

  • 12vDC domestic system with 220v ring main from generator and shorepower.

 

Battery Banks:

  • 2 x 120Ah gel engine start batteries (2020).
  • 2 x 140Ah gel start batteries to power windlass and furling system (2020).
  • 4 x 120Ah gel domestic batteries (2020).
  • 1 x Generator start battery – lead acid (2018).

 

Battery Chargers:

  • New 2023 battery charger.
  • Victron generator battery charger.
  • Mastervolt 100 24volt battery charger linked to gel service batteries (2020).

 

Alternators:

  • 2 x 12v engine alternators (2020).

 

Generator:

  • Fisher Panda 6.3KVA (2010).
  • Overhauled and replacement solenoid fitted 2021.
  • Generator hours – approx. 480 as of July 2021.
  • Generator last serviced April 2021.

 

Shore Power:

  • 220v shore power connection.

 

Other Electrical:

  • Mastervolt inverter linked to gel service batteries.

Plumbing Systems

Fresh Water & Water Heating System:

  • Plumbing for washing machine.
  • New washing machine available. Currently uninstalled.

 

Watermaker:

  • Sea Recovery AVM400-1 64 L/hour.
  • Unused in this ownership and currently decommissioned.

 

Bilge Pumps:

  • 1 x Manual bilge pump.
  • 1 x Electric bilge pump.

Tankage

Fuel:

  • 1,200L in 1 x Mild steel tanks.

 

Fresh water:

  • 1,200L in 2 x Mild steel interconnecting tanks (formed by the hull sides and baffled).
  • 1 x Polythene water tank connected to a floor pump at the galley sink (located stern cabin).

 

Grey/Blackwater holding tanks:

  • Stainless steel tank beneath forward port bunk could possibly be used as a holding tank if necessary (currently used to supply water to manual pump to the forward wash basin).

Navigation Equipment

In cockpit:

  • Furuno Navnet radar/chartplotter.
  • AIS transponder.
  • 2 x Autopilots.
  • Furuno Navpilot 500.
  • Necco NM692.
  • Logic log, compass, wind, depth.
  • Raytheon rudder indicator.
  • Sestral magnetic compass.
  • Furuno GP 32 GPS.
  • Nasa Navtex pro receiver.

 

At chart table:

  • Furuno GPS.
  • Navtex.

 

Communications Equipment:

  • Furuno AIS transceiver.

Domestic Equipment

Galley:

  • Force 10 oven.
  • 147L Isotherm seawater cooled fridge (compressor refurb 2021).
  • 64L seawater cooled freezer (compressor refurb 2021).  

 

Heads/Showers:

  • Lavac Taylors baby Blake manual head.

 

Heating & Ventilation:

  • CLD Air-con (unused in this ownership; unsure if operational).

 

Entertainment:

  • Vtex TV with DVD player.

Accommodation

Summary of Accommodation:

  • 6 berths in 2 cabins + saloon.
  • Interior finish in mahogany on marine ply, good condition.
  • Sole boards in holly and mahogany on marine ply, good condition.
  • Headlining material from Noridas and Jongerts, good condition.
  • 1.9m headroom.
  • Twin bunks in V formation in forward cabin.
  • Double berth in owner’s cabin amidships.
  • Above the nav., station there is a pull out canvas passage berth.
  • 2 x New berth cushions covered in blue fabric and piped to serve as berths/seating in the deckhouse. Both tailored to the teak seats and currently stored in the forward cabin.
  • In the aft saloon, there is a berth above the seating by the transom window.
  • Thus it is possible to sleep up to 8 in comfort.
  • Quality mattresses in cabins, replaced in this ownership.
  • Owner's cabin has an ergonomically designed wood frame slats beneath which makes for a comfortable bed.
  • All coverings are either in good order or virtually new condition.

Deck Equipment

Rig:

  • Ketch rigged.
  • Aluminium mast (1993).
  • Hood/Rondal hydro in mast furling (1992) overhauled (2007).
  • Hydraulic furling genoa.

 

Winches:

  • 2 x Andersen 52 ST genoa winches.
  • 2 x Andersen 46 ST staysail winches.
  • 3 x Goyot halyard winches on main mast.
  • 1 x Lewmar 44 ST halyard winch on mainmast.
  •  1 x Andersen 46 ST furling winch.
  • Mizzen 1 Goyot and a Lewmar 8 reef.

 

Sails:

  • In-mast furling main of 29.6 m2 (9,52 Oz).
  • Furling jib 35.2 m2 (8,4 Oz).
  • Furling inner staysail 19.2 m2 (9,4 Oz).
  • Mizzen 15.2 m2 (8,52 Oz).

 

Anchoring & Mooring Equipment:

  • Loftrans Tigress 1000 24 volt electric windlass.
  • 100m of 10mm chain.
  • 1 x Delta anchor on bow.
  • 1 x CQR anchor on bow.
  • 1 x Fisherman’s anchor stored in chocks on the bow.

 

Covers, Canvas & Cushions:

  • Cream canvas cockpit enclosure – needs replacing.

 

Tender & Outboard:

  • Simpson transom mounted davits.
  • Avon dinghy.
  • Yamaha 4hp 4 stroke.  

 

Safety Equipment:

  • 4 x Life jackets.
  • 1 x Life raft (out of service).

 

Fire-fighting equipment:

  • 4 x Fire extinguishers.
